Imagine que você seja um analista de compliance em uma grande instituição financeira. Para garantir que a empresa cumpra todas as regulamentações financeiras vigentes, você precisa acessar constantemente uma série de documentos sigilosos: relatórios de auditoria, transações bancárias detalhadas, comunicações internas, contratos em formatos diversos (PDF, XML, HTML), além de planilhas complexas e dados sensíveis armazenados em imagens digitalizadas. A consulta desses documentos é muito trabalhosa e pode levar a falhas humanas. Estas informações também são confidenciais e por isso não podem ser inseridas para pesquisa, por exemplo, no ChatGTP. Não existe uma garantia de sigilo. O RAG resolve esse problema lhe dando o poder da Inteligência Artificial em LLMs para você ser muito mais produtivo e assertivo.
Sempre que uma consulta ou uma revisão regulatória é necessária, você utiliza o RAG como uma “biblioteca digital segura”, onde esses documentos são armazenados e organizados de forma protegida. O RAG permite que você pesquise e recupere instantaneamente informações específicas de interesse para utilizá-los junto com LLMs, como históricos de transações em datas específicas ou detalhes de contratos que estejam sob escrutínio regulatório.
Por exemplo, ao receber um pedido de auditoria externa questionando a legalidade de certas transações, o RAG pode ser configurado para extrair rapidamente todos os documentos relevantes, como contratos associados e registros de comunicação com as partes envolvidas em pesquisas via LLMs. Isso não só agiliza o processo de conformidade, mas também garante que todas as informações utilizadas sejam precisas e estejam de acordo com as políticas internas de segurança da informação.
Para atender clientes em demanda de solução de RAG, utilizamos a seguinte metodologia:
1. Definição Objetivo, Criação e Otimização de Base de Conhecimento RAG
Visão Geral: Definimos um objetivo principal do resultado do trabalho de RAG. Esse objetivo guiará todas as decisões dos passos seguintes. Central para um sistema RAG de sucesso é uma base de conhecimento e dados robustos e bem organizados, dos quais pode-se recuperar informações. Este serviço é dedicado ao desenvolvimento e melhoria contínua deste recurso crítico. Trabalhamos para compilar, estruturar e otimizar seus dados para servir como uma fundação dinâmica para o modelo RAG.
Criação: O processo começa com a definição do objetivo e a agregação de documentos existentes, bancos de dados e outras formas de dados relevantes para suas operações: docx, pdf, tabelas em pdfs, htmls, etc necessários para atingir esse objetivo. Em seguida, estruturamos essas informações em um formato estruturado e pesquisável que é facilmente acessível pelo sistema RAG. Isso inclui o uso de técnicas de metadados e indexação para melhorar a eficiência e precisão da recuperação.
Otimização: Nossa equipe aplica técnicas avançadas para limpar e normalizar os dados, garantindo entradas de alta qualidade que melhoram a precisão das saídas do sistema. Monitoramos continuamente o desempenho da base de conhecimento e fazemos ajustes conforme necessário, baseados em feedback dos usuários e análises do sistema. Esse processo de otimização iterativo é chave para manter a relevância e eficiência do sistema RAG.
Expansão: À medida que seu negócio cresce e evolui, também crescerão as demandas colocadas em seu sistema RAG. Oferecemos serviços para expandir e atualizar sua base de conhecimento, adicionando novas informações e fontes que mantêm seu sistema RAG na vanguarda das necessidades de sua indústria.
2. Implementação e Integração Personalizada de RAG
Visão Geral: Este serviço foca no design e na implantação de um sistema de Geração Aumentada por Recuperação (RAG) personalizado que se integra perfeitamente à sua infraestrutura tecnológica existente. Nossa abordagem é criar uma solução que aproveite seus conjuntos de dados exclusivos e as necessidades dos usuários, garantindo que o sistema RAG aprimore efetivamente as operações de seu negócio.
Processo: Começamos realizando uma avaliação completa de seus sistemas atuais e repositórios de dados. Isso nos permite entender os desafios e oportunidades específicas dentro de sua organização. Com base nesta análise, desenvolvemos um modelo RAG personalizado que se integra suavemente ao seu ambiente de TI, garantindo uma interrupção mínima dos processos existentes. Priorizamos a escalabilidade e a segurança para atender às demandas futuras e proteger a integridade de seus dados.
Integração: Após o desenvolvimento do sistema RAG, focamos na integração. Isso envolve configurar as interfaces necessárias entre o sistema RAG e seus bancos de dados, plataformas de atendimento ao cliente ou quaisquer outros sistemas relevantes. Nosso objetivo é garantir que o sistema RAG funcione como uma parte integral de seu fluxo de trabalho operacional, melhorando as capacidades de tomada de decisão e recuperação de informações.
Treinamento e Implementação: Oferecemos treinamento abrangente para suas equipes para garantir que estão equipadas para usar e manter o sistema RAG de forma eficaz. A fase de implementação é cuidadosamente gerenciada para garantir uma adoção suave, e oferecemos suporte durante essa fase para tratar quaisquer desafios que surjam durante a transição.
3. Suporte e Aprimoramento Contínuos de RAG
Visão Geral: A implementação de um sistema RAG é apenas o começo. Para garantir que ele continue atendendo às necessidades em evolução de seu negócio, o suporte contínuo e aprimoramentos periódicos são essenciais. Este serviço oferece monitoramento contínuo, solução de problemas e atualização de seu sistema RAG para manter sua eficácia e eficiência.
Suporte: Nossos serviços de suporte incluem verificações regulares do sistema e solução de problemas para garantir desempenho ótimo e resolver rapidamente quaisquer problemas que surjam. Oferecemos suporte remoto por especialistas prontos para assisti-lo a qualquer momento.
Aprimoramentos: As tecnologias e as necessidades de negócios mudam ao longo do tempo, e nossos serviços de aprimoramento garantem que seu sistema RAG permaneça atualizado com os últimos avanços em IA e aprendizado de máquina. Isso inclui atualizar algoritmos, expandir a base de conhecimento e integrar novas fontes de dados para manter o sistema eficaz e competitivo.
Consultoria Estratégica: Além do suporte técnico, oferecemos conselhos estratégicos sobre como melhor aproveitar seu sistema RAG para alcançar os objetivos de negócios. Isso pode incluir insights sobre novos possíveis usos, melhorias na eficiência e integração com outras tecnologias emergentes. Nosso objetivo é garantir que seu investimento em tecnologia RAG continue gerando benefícios substanciais para o negócio ao longo do tempo.
Segurança dos dados: Embora a solução de RAG permita o tratamento de dados confidenciais em modelos de linguagem de grande escala (LLMs), é importante destacar que não abordamos neste documento técnicas específicas como criptografia end-to-end, gerenciamento de acesso baseado em roles ou redes privadas virtuais (VPNs) para assegurar que os dados em modo RAG permaneçam protegidos. Este aspecto da segurança é crucial e pode ser gerenciado utilizando ferramentas internas do cliente ou, alternativamente, podemos incluir esse suporte como um adendo aos nossos serviços. Esta abordagem garante flexibilidade para que nossos clientes possam escolher a melhor forma de integrar e proteger seus dados sensíveis, conforme suas próprias políticas de segurança e requisitos regulatórios.